As an RN Hospice Case Manager, you plan, organize, and direct hospice care. The professional nurse builds from the resources of the community to plan and direct services to meet the needs of individuals and families within their homes and communities.

Duties & Responsibilities

Supervise hospice aides.

Complete an initial, comprehensive assessment of the patient and family to determine hospice needs.

Provide a complete physical assessment and history of current and previous illnesses.

Provide professional nursing care by utilizing all elements of the nursing process.

Assess and evaluate the patient’s status by writing and initiating a plan of care, regularly re-evaluating needs, and revising the plan of care as necessary.

Initiate the plan of care and make necessary revisions as patient status and needs change.

Use health assessment data to determine nursing diagnosis.

Develop a care plan with goals based on nursing diagnosis, incorporating palliative nursing actions, and involve the patient and family in planning.

Initiate appropriate preventive and rehabilitative nursing procedures and administer medications and treatments as prescribed by the physician in the plan of care.

Counsel the patient and family in meeting nursing and related needs.

Provide health care instructions to the patient as appropriate per assessment and plan.

Assist the patient with activities of daily living and support self-sufficiency and comfort care where appropriate.

Act as Case Manager when assigned and coordinate care for the caseload.
